Understanding Economic Indicators: A Closer Look at⁢ Canada⁣ and ‌Alabama’s Wealth Disparities

To grasp the ⁢economic⁢ landscape of ‌Canada and Alabama, one must delve‌ into​ several critical economic indicators that offer a clearer picture of wealth disparities. Gross Domestic Product (GDP), ‍ income levels, ‍and employment rates are fundamental metrics that play a significant role in assessing economic health. canada’s GDP‍ per‍ capita stands impressively high at approximately $52,000, compared⁣ to Alabama’s‍ $32,000,⁣ highlighting a stark income divide. ​Moreover, ⁤the employment rate in⁤ Canada​ is significantly bolstered by varied industries such as ⁣technology and natural ​resources, whereas Alabama’s ​economy is heavily reliant on manufacturing and agriculture, leading to different ‌employment​ opportunities and wage levels.

The disparities ⁢aren’t merely numerical;​ they⁢ reflect broader social implications, including ​ healthcare access, education quality, and social⁤ safety nets. In ⁣Canada, ‌public healthcare reduces individual financial burdens, while Alabama’s healthcare system is more privatized, ⁢frequently‌ enough leading​ to higher personal expenses. Furthermore, ‍education investment varies, with Canadian provinces ‍generally allocating more resources per student​ than Alabama, impacting ​job readiness and economic mobility.⁢ A closer examination of these elements reveals that mere comparisons of income figures ‍do not encapsulate the intricate layers of economic stratification ⁢that shape‍ the ⁤lives⁣ of residents ⁢in⁤ both regions.

Policy​ Recommendations for Bridging Economic⁣ Gaps: Strategies for Sustainable Growth in Canada⁤ and Alabama

Addressing economic disparities between regions ⁢such as Canada and⁤ Alabama requires a multifaceted approach ⁢focused on​ sustainable ⁣growth. Investing in ​education and workforce advancement is crucial ‍to ensure that ⁣individuals possess⁢ the ‌skills​ needed for ⁣emerging industries. This strategy can be enhanced by collaborating with‍ local ‌businesses to align ‍educational programs​ with labor market demands. Additionally, ‌fostering entrepreneurship through grants and low-interest loans⁣ can stimulate small business development,⁣ particularly in underserved communities. Hear are a⁤ few key areas for policy consideration:

  • Enhancing vocational‌ training programs tailored to industry⁣ needs
  • Implementing ⁣tax incentives for companies that ​invest​ in local workforce development
  • Creating incubator⁢ programs ‌for start-ups focused on technology and innovation

Furthermore,investing in ​infrastructure ​can significantly contribute to closing‌ the economic gap. When regions improve their transportation,broadband access,and public services,they not‍ only enhance the quality of life⁣ for residents but ​also attract business investment.Policymakers should consider the⁣ following ‍strategies to improve infrastructure:

Strategy Description
Public-Private Partnerships Leverage private sector⁢ investment to fund essential infrastructure projects.
Green ​Infrastructure Initiatives promote sustainability through eco-friendly ⁣projects that create ‍jobs​ while protecting⁣ the environment.
Universal⁤ Broadband access Ensure all⁣ communities, especially rural areas,‌ have reliable internet ​access‌ to participate in the digital​ economy.
